Azure Databricks Hands-on Lab

Abstract and learning objectives

In this workshop, you will deploy an Azure Databricks workspace and experiment with access data from Azure Storage in form of CSV or Parquet files and transform this data using PySpark and SparkSQL.

Note: This lab is designed to complement the classroom presentation and the instructor will guide the attendees which exercises should be attempted in which order.

Task1: Install Azure Storage Explorer

Microsoft Azure Storage Explorer is a standalone app that makes it easy to work with Azure Storage data on Windows, macOS, and Linux (Azure Docs on Storage Explorer here)

  1. Download Azure Storage Explorer from this page

  2. Install Azure Storage Explorer

  3. Click the Open Connect dialog

  4. Select “Add an Azure account” and continue logging in to your Azure account.

  5. Once you log in you can see a list of your storage accounts.

Task4: Deploy an Azure Storage Account as below

  1. Search for Storage Accounts

  2. Click Add

  3. Provide subscription, resource group

  4. For Storage account name: hol<your name>storage for example: holjohnstorage

  5. Select Location

  6. For Account Kind Storage V2

  7. For Replication change to LRS

  8. Click “Review + Create” and then “Create”

Task5: Deploy Azure Databricks

  1. Search for “Databricks” in Azure portal

  2. Click Add

  3. In Creation screen:

    1. Select your subscription

    2. Select your Resource Group

    3. Provide the name hol-<yourname>-databricks

    4. Select Location

    5. Pricing Tier: Trial

    6. click Review+Create

    7. Click Create
